  Give Way

  I know a man from Lancashire
who had a horse and cart for hire.
The horse was old but the cart is strong,
somehow together they didn't belong.

When they became one there was a change,
Ears went up, whip in the tail, snap the riegns.
They came to a bridge, it looked a little weak
As they crossed, it hobbled, tapped and creaked.

The wooden bridge was small and norrow
not to long, but only room for one to pass.
Towards them flapped a little brown sparrow,
horse thinks, no way he's makin me into an ass.

The old horse snorted and put his head down,
nothing would stop them getting to town.
Said the horse: ' no one's gettin in my way'
Then the little sparrow flew up, got out the way.

Hovering above watching everything,
just like a slow motion scene.
The sparrow saw the horse
fly through the trucks screen.

P.S. We used a proffessional stunt horse, he is Ok.

David Darbyshire
